数据库概念结构是什么关系

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库概念结构是指数据库的逻辑组织方式和数据之间的关系。它包括了三个关键概念:实体、属性和关系。下面将详细介绍这三个概念的关系。

    1. 实体(Entity):实体是指现实世界中具有独立存在和可识别性的事物。在数据库中,实体通常用表来表示。每个实体都有一个唯一的标识符,称为主键。实体可以有多个属性,用于描述实体的特征。

    2. 属性(Attribute):属性是指实体的特征或描述。每个实体可以有多个属性,每个属性具有特定的数据类型。属性可以是单值的,也可以是多值的。例如,对于一个学生实体,属性可以包括学生的姓名、年龄、性别等。

    3. 关系(Relationship):关系是指不同实体之间的联系。关系可以是一对一的、一对多的或多对多的。关系用于描述实体之间的依赖关系和关联关系。例如,一个学生实体和一个班级实体之间可以建立一对多的关系,一个班级可以包含多个学生。

    在数据库中,这三个概念之间的关系是通过数据模型来表示的。常见的数据模型包括层次模型、网状模型和关系模型。关系模型是最常用的一种模型,它使用表来表示实体和关系,使用关系代数和关系演算来进行查询和操作。

    总结起来,数据库概念结构是通过实体、属性和关系来描述和组织数据的方式。实体表示具有独立存在和可识别性的事物,属性表示实体的特征或描述,关系表示不同实体之间的联系。通过这些概念,数据库可以对数据进行有效的管理和操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的概念结构是指数据库的逻辑组织和存储方式,它描述了数据库中数据的组织方式、数据之间的关系以及数据的约束条件等。数据库的概念结构通常以数据模型的形式进行描述,常见的数据模型有层次模型、网络模型、关系模型和面向对象模型等。

    关系模型是目前应用最广泛的数据模型,它将数据组织成一张二维表,即关系表。关系表由若干行和若干列组成,每一行表示一个记录,每一列表示一个属性。表中的每个单元格存储一个数据值,每个记录由一个唯一的标识符(主键)来标识。关系模型通过建立表与表之间的关系来表示数据之间的联系。关系模型的主要特点是数据的结构化和灵活性高,易于查询和维护。

    在关系模型中,数据之间的关系由外键来表示。外键是指一个表中的属性,它引用了另一个表中的主键。通过外键,可以建立表与表之间的关联关系,实现数据的一致性和完整性。外键约束可以限制数据的插入、更新和删除操作,保证了数据的正确性和完整性。

    除了关系模型,还有其他的数据模型。层次模型将数据组织成树形结构,每个节点表示一个实体,每个节点可以有多个子节点,但只能有一个父节点。网络模型将数据组织成图形结构,每个节点可以有多个父节点和多个子节点。面向对象模型将数据组织成对象的集合,每个对象包含属性和方法。

    总之,数据库的概念结构是数据库中数据的组织方式和关系的描述,不同的数据模型有不同的概念结构,关系模型是目前应用最广泛的数据模型。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库的概念结构是指数据库的逻辑结构,即数据库中各个数据元素之间的关系。数据库的概念结构是通过概念模型来描述的,常用的概念模型有层次模型、网状模型和关系模型。其中,关系模型是最常用的概念模型。

    关系模型是基于关系代数和关系演算理论的数据库模型。它将数据组织成若干个关系表,每个关系表由若干个属性组成,每个属性对应一个域。关系表中的每一行代表一个记录,每一列代表一个属性。关系模型通过定义关系表之间的关系来描述数据之间的联系和依赖。

    在关系模型中,数据的逻辑结构由以下几个要素组成:

    1. 关系(Relation):关系是数据的逻辑组织形式,是由若干个属性组成的二维表。每个关系都有一个关系名,用于唯一标识该关系。

    2. 属性(Attribute):属性是关系表中的列,代表了数据的某个特征或属性。每个属性有一个属性名,用于唯一标识该属性。

    3. 元组(Tuple):元组是关系表中的一行,代表了一个记录或实例。每个元组由属性值组成,每个属性值对应一个属性。

    4. 域(Domain):域是属性的取值范围,即属性值的类型。每个属性都有一个域,用于限制属性值的类型。

    5. 码(Key):码是用来唯一标识元组的属性或属性组合。一个关系表可以有一个或多个码,其中一个码被选为主码。

    6. 外键(Foreign Key):外键是一个关系表中的属性,它引用了另一个关系表的主码。外键用于建立不同关系表之间的联系。

    数据库的概念结构描述了数据之间的关系和依赖,是数据库设计的基础。通过对概念结构的分析和设计,可以实现对数据的有效组织、存储和检索。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部